The Impact of Weight on Joint Health

Carrying extra weight places additional stress on weight-bearing joints, particularly in the knees, hips, and lower back. Each additional pound increases the load on your joints, leading to faster wear and tear. By managing your weight effectively, you can reduce pressure, improve mobility, and minimize discomfort.

One of the best approaches to weight management is focusing on a balanced diet rich in anti-inflammatory foods. Incorporating leafy greens, lean proteins, healthy fats, and whole grains can help reduce inflammation and support overall joint health. Hydration is equally important, as water helps lubricate the joints and maintain their function.

Staying Active for Joint Pain Management

Regular movement is essential for keeping joints flexible and strong. While intense workouts may not always be feasible for those with joint pain, low-impact activities like swimming, cycling, and yoga provide effective ways to stay active without putting excessive strain on the joints.

Strength training is also crucial, as it helps build muscle support around the joints. Stronger muscles take on more of the workload, reducing stress on the joints themselves. Incorporating stretching and mobility exercises can further enhance flexibility and prevent stiffness. For those experiencing persistent discomfort, working with a professional to develop a tailored exercise routine can make all the difference.

The Role of Posture in Joint Health

Poor posture can contribute significantly to joint pain, particularly in the spine, shoulders, and knees. Sitting or standing with improper alignment places unnecessary strain on joints, leading to chronic discomfort over time. Making simple adjustments to posture, such as maintaining a neutral spine while sitting and keeping weight evenly distributed while standing, can help prevent long-term joint issues.

Ergonomic modifications, such as using a supportive chair or standing desk, can also improve posture and reduce joint stress. Strengthening core and back muscles through targeted exercises further promotes proper alignment, ultimately supporting joint health.

The Power of Nutrition in Joint Pain Management

The foods you consume can have a profound impact on joint health. An anti-inflammatory diet rich in om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, and essential vitamins can help reduce pain and improve mobility. Fatty fish like salmon, nuts, seeds, and leafy greens are excellent choices for supporting joint function.

Collagen-rich foods, such as bone broth, also promote joint repair and flexibility. Additionally, maintaining adequate vitamin D and calcium levels is crucial for bone strength, further contributing to joint stability and reducing the risk of injury.

The Importance of Hydration for Joint Health

Water is essential for maintaining healthy joints, as it helps keep cartilage lubricated and functioning properly. Dehydration can lead to increased friction in the joints, exacerbating pain and stiffness. Aim to drink enough water throughout the day and consider consuming hydrating foods like cucumbers, oranges, and watermelon.

Avoiding excessive caffeine and alcohol intake is also beneficial, as both can contribute to dehydration and inflammation. Making a conscious effort to stay hydrated can go a long way in supporting overall joint health.
